Thanks for the review. One thing to add is that the 51 has LFP battery chemistry (as opposed to the bigger battery models which have NMC) - which in moderate to warm climates is a good thing! Apart from being cheaper to make, in theory they are rated for double the number of charge cycles (so should last longer) and also you can regularly charge it to 100% without worrying about prematurely ageing the battery.
@kirkserpes2574
@kirkserpes2574 11 месяцев назад
While it's true that the LFP lasts longer, the expected life of the NMC batteries is still longer than the expected life of the car. You'd probably get between 200k - 300k out of the NMC, vs 500k for the LFP all things being the same. The other thing to consider is that since the NMC are larger capacity, losing a few % more than an LFP still leaves you with more real world range. Both chemistries will degrade over time regardless of use so the NMC definitely has a few things going for it. When are we going to have solar panels on EVs' roofs?
@johngordon9987
@johngordon9987 11 месяцев назад
Some have done it, but solar panels do not generate a lot of power so they won't add much to the range, and typically not worth the extra cost.
@1DonFF
@1DonFF 10 месяцев назад
@@johngordon9987it’s not about generating a lot of power. On average 3-5 miles a hour with a solar panel is so worth it, just leave my car parked in the sun while at work or out having fun….
@johngordon9987
@johngordon9987 10 месяцев назад
@@1DonFF 3-5 miles an hour of added energy would imply at least 1kW from the solar panel. Rooftop solar panels on homes (larger than the average car roof) generate max 400W when angled perfectly. They are also 12-24V - a long way off the 400V needed for charging a traction battery. Most likely, you'd end up using an inverter to get 110V/220V AC and connecting to the car's AC charger - all of which incur losses. I would be surprised if you could get even 1 mile an hour from a rooftop panel on a perfect day (which is probably why the few I've seen that have added them use the power to cool the interior rather than charge the battery).
